April 2011 Inflation Rates Rise in Italy

In April 2011, Italy’s national consumer price index (NIC) increased by 0.5% monthly and 2.6% annually compared to April 2010. The IPCA, an harmonized index, rose 1.0% monthly and 2.9% annually. Inflation for the broader population (FOI) grew 0.5% monthly and 2.6% annually. Core inflation, excluding energy and fresh food, reached 1.8%, up from 1.7% in March. Energy and transport services drove inflation, with regulated energy prices contributing significantly. Monthly price increases for frequently purchased goods rose 0.3%, while medium-frequency items surged 1.0% monthly. Annual inflation for goods hit 2.9%, outpacing services’ 2.2% growth, narrowing the goods-services inflation gap by 0.1 percentage points.
